The Raiders suffered another setback on Thursday night, losing 10-7 to the Broncos while their quarterback Geno Smith sustained an injury.

Geno Smith's Injury Details

Smith finished the game with 143 passing yards and one interception. He was hurt on the first play of the fourth quarter while attempting to evade Denver linebacker Nik Bonitto. Bonitto made contact with Smith's right knee, causing him to stumble awkwardly before falling to the ground under Malcolm Roach.

Smith was briefly replaced by Kenny Pickett but returned before being ruled questionable to continue due to a left quad issue.

Overall Team Performance

The offense struggled significantly, managing only 188 total yards. This defeat dropped the Raiders to a 2-7 record for the season.
